Newton King Cup

One of the highlights of the Gisborne Club's activities is the annual trial for the Newton King Cup. This year, the club drove to Tokomaru Bay and returned to Gisborne. One car made the trip without the loss of any marks. Driven by Hans Kwak, the car was navigated by his girlfriend, Pat James. This is quite an achievement in car-club circles as special conditions are imposed on the drivers and usually their destination is unknown. A series of checkpoints are set up along the route where further instructions are received which take them to the next check.

The various activities of car clubs generally, help to improve driving conditions for all road users as they report unsuspected hazards to the authorities and vehicle faults to manufacturers.
